Overview: The Lynn Haven City Commission meeting focused on issues such as recreational vehicle (RV) regulations, city manager compensation for holiday work, and updates to the city’s comprehensive plan. Discussions revealed growing concerns over RV violations in residential areas, the need for formalizing city manager compensation decisions, and necessary updates to city planning documents.

Overview: The Lynn Haven City Commission meeting focused on several issues, most notably the proposal to introduce a city clerk position as a measure to enhance checks and balances within city governance. This proposal sparked debate among commissioners and community members, reflecting differing opinions on its necessity and implications for transparency and efficiency. Additionally, the meeting addressed ongoing concerns about the city manager’s contract and compensation, the extension of the Finance Review Committee, and various infrastructure projects.

Overview: The Lynn Haven City Commission held a meeting where they decided to remove speed bumps from the Mt. Highlands neighborhood, following community feedback about the bumps’ impact on daily life. This decision was part of a broader agenda that addressed various local issues, including upcoming ordinances and community events.
